Using AI for Content in 2026 Without Hurting Your SEO

Automatically generated content (AGC) is content created primarily by algorithms, scripts, or AI tools with minimal human input. It’s often generic and low-quality, and it feels spammy. Exactly the kind of content Google has long said it doesn’t want in search results. Will Google Penalize The Content? Google’s focus has always been on helpful, original […]
